Foundation Overview
Based in Orlando, FL, Robert R Scott Charitable Remainder has awarded 50 grants totaling $507,770 to organizations in Kentucky. Individual grants range from $3,592 to $15,498, with a median award of $9,299.

Form 990-PF Research Tips
-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
-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
-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
-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
